Subject: [PATCH v2 03/14] xen/grant-table: stop setting PG_private on pages for grant mapping
Date: Mon, 31 Aug 2026 15:25:26 -0400	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260831-remove-pg_private-v2-3-3668159cd9e8@nvidia.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20260831-remove-pg_private-v2-0-3668159cd9e8@nvidia.com>

gnttab_alloc_pages() stores xen_page_foreign in page->private. On 32-bit, a
pointer to an allocated xen_page_foreign is stored; on 64-bit,
xen_page_foreign is stored inline. Checking page->private != NULL is enough
to tell whether a xen_page_foreign needs to be freed on 32-bit and
page->private is zeroed unconditionally on 64-bit.

It prepares for a future commit that remove PG_private.

No functional change intended.

---
 drivers/xen/balloon.c     |  5 +++++
 drivers/xen/grant-table.c | 11 +++++------
 2 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/xen/balloon.c b/drivers/xen/balloon.c
index e7f74ea7cd5eb..fdb18348cfdfe 100644
--- a/drivers/xen/balloon.c
+++ b/drivers/xen/balloon.c
@@ -182,6 +182,11 @@ static struct page *balloon_retrieve(bool require_lowmem)
 
 	__ClearPageOffline(page);
 	dec_node_page_state(page, NR_BALLOON_PAGES);
+	/*
+	 * clear page->private before giving it out, since it might be used to
+	 * store xen_page_foreign info.
+	 */
+	set_page_private(page, 0);
 
 	return page;
 }
diff --git a/drivers/xen/grant-table.c b/drivers/xen/grant-table.c
index 69922be28b54c..993f89f048e21 100644
--- a/drivers/xen/grant-table.c
+++ b/drivers/xen/grant-table.c
@@ -863,10 +863,10 @@ E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(gnttab_free_auto_xlat_frames);
 
 int gnttab_pages_set_private(int nr_pages, struct page **pages)
 {
+#if BITS_PER_LONG < 64
 	int i;
 
 	for (i = 0; i < nr_pages; i++) {
-#if BITS_PER_LONG < 64
 		struct xen_page_foreign *foreign;
 
 		foreign = kzalloc_obj(*foreign);
@@ -874,9 +874,9 @@ int gnttab_pages_set_private(int nr_pages, struct page **pages)
 			return -ENOMEM;
 
 		set_page_private(pages[i], (unsigned long)foreign);
-#endif
-		SetPagePrivate(pages[i]);
 	}
+#endif
+	/* Data is stored in page->private on 64-bit */
 
 	return 0;
 }
@@ -1031,12 +1031,11 @@ void gnttab_pages_clear_private(int nr_pages, struct page **pages)
 	int i;
 
 	for (i = 0; i < nr_pages; i++) {
-		if (PagePrivate(pages[i])) {
 #if BITS_PER_LONG < 64
+		if (page_private(pages[i]))
 			kfree((void *)page_private(pages[i]));
 #endif
-			ClearPagePrivate(pages[i]);
-		}
+		set_page_private(pages[i], 0);
 	}
 }
 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(gnttab_pages_clear_private);
